vendor/assets/javascripts/webshims/shims/styles/forms-ext.css in webshims-rails-1.14.4 vs vendor/assets/javascripts/webshims/shims/styles/forms-ext.css in webshims-rails-1.14.5
- old
+ new
@@ -20,10 +20,13 @@
/* btn api */
.hide-spinbtns + .input-buttons > .step-controls,
.hide-spinbtns .input-buttons > .step-controls {
display: none;
}
+.hide-spinbtns input[type="number"], [type="number"].hide-spinbtns {
+ -moz-appearance: textfield;
+}
.hide-spinbtns::-webkit-inner-spin-button,
.hide-spinbtns ::-webkit-inner-spin-button {
display: none;
}
@@ -34,10 +37,13 @@
.hide-inputbtns + .input-buttons,
.hide-inputbtns .input-buttons {
display: none;
}
+.hide-inputbtns input[type="number"], [type="number"].hide-inputbtns {
+ -moz-appearance: textfield;
+}
.hide-inputbtns::-webkit-inner-spin-button,
.hide-inputbtns ::-webkit-inner-spin-button {
display: none;
}
@@ -188,10 +194,14 @@
.ws-inputreplace[readonly][aria-readonly="false"][disabled] {
cursor: default;
cursor: not-allowed;
}
+.ws-number[readonly][aria-readonly="false"] {
+ cursor: default;
+}
+
.input-buttons,
.step-controls,
.ws-popover-opener {
zoom: 1;
overflow: hidden;
@@ -295,15 +305,13 @@
.input-button-size-2.ws-is-rtl {
margin-left: 0;
margin-right: -39px;
}
.input-button-size-2 .step-controls {
- visibility: hidden;
opacity: 0;
}
:focus + .input-button-size-2 .step-controls, :hover + .input-button-size-2 .step-controls, :active + .input-button-size-2 .step-controls, .input-button-size-2:hover .step-controls {
opacity: 1;
- visibility: visible;
}
.step-controls {
transition: all 300ms;
}